Legacy Identity Systems: The Old DNA

Traditional identity systems in finance were built around centralised control. Customers proved who they were with documents- passports, driver’s licenses, utility bills- often presented in person at a bank branch or office.

These credentials were checked manually, signatures matched by eye, and the results recorded in siloed databases. The process was slow, labour-intensive, and riddled with friction: onboarding could take days, weeks or even months, with customers forced to repeat the same ritual for every new account or service.

But the limitations ran deeper than inconvenience. Centralised systems created single points of failure, honeypots for hackers and fraudsters. Human error and document forgery slipped through the cracks, while synthetic identities, cobbled together from real and fake data, bypassed outdated controls.

For the unbanked, those lacking government documents or a fixed address, access to financial services was often impossible. Regulatory compliance became an arduous task, as manual processes struggled to keep pace with evolving standards like GDPR and PSD2. In short, legacy identity systems were ill-equipped for the digital economy's scale, speed, and security demands.

The Shift to Dynamic, User-Controlled Identity

Today, identity is often established and authenticated through mobile-first approaches, biometrics, and decentralised frameworks that leverage blockchain and cryptography. Here are some of the most important parameters in user-controlled identity:

Biometrics (such as facial recognition and fingerprint scans) offer a unique, hard-to-forge link between a person and their digital presence. It is increasingly used for secure onboarding and authentication in fintech.

Phone-centric identity leverages the ubiquity and behavioural data of mobile devices. Analysing signals like phone tenure, SIM swaps, and device possession provides a real-time, high-trust proxy for digital identity, far more dynamic and fraud-resistant than credentials.

Blockchain-based and self-sovereign identity (SSI) systems represent the most radical departure. Individuals create and control decentralised identifiers (DIDS) and verifiable credentials, stored in digital wallets rather than central databases. These credentials can be selectively shared, cryptographically verified, and, crucially, revoked or updated at the user’s discretion.

Empowering Users: Control, Privacy, and Revocation

Unlike traditional systems, where organisations or governments own and manage identity data, dynamic identity models put individuals in the driver’s seat. Users can now determine what information to share, with whom, and for how long, enhancing privacy and security.

  • Selective Disclosure: With verifiable credentials and zero-knowledge proofs, users can prove facts (like being over 18) without exposing unrelated personal details.
  • Revocation and Access Control: Individuals can grant, limit, or revoke access to their data in real time, enforcing the “right to be forgotten” and minimising the risk of unauthorised sharing or breaches.
  • Portability and Interoperability: Credentials are not locked to a single provider or platform. Instead, they can be used across services and borders, reducing friction and empowering users to manage their digital identity holistically.

Regulatory Catalysts and the Push for Interoperability

This shift is not happening in a vacuum. Regulatory frameworks are both responding to and accelerating the evolution of digital identity:

  • eIDAS 2.0 in the European Union mandates the rollout of interoperable digital identity wallets for all citizens, enabling secure, cross-border access to public and private services while prioritising user control and privacy.
  • GDPR enshrines the right of individuals to access, correct, and erase their data, propelling the adoption of privacy-by-design identity solutions and reinforcing user empowerment.
  • PSD2 (Payment Services Directive 2) in Europe requires strong customer authentication and secure identity verification in financial transactions, driving innovation in dynamic, multi-factor authentication methods.

Interoperability is now a central pillar, with open standards (such as those from the W3C and regional frameworks) ensuring that digital identities can be recognised and trusted across platforms, industries, and jurisdictions. This harmonisation is essential for realising the promise of user-controlled identity at scale.

Case Studies: Institutions Embedding Identity into Their Core Architecture

Real-world examples reveal how leading financial institutions embed identity at the heart of their technology stacks, transforming security and customer experience. From established banks to decentralised finance (DeFi) pioneers, these organisations illustrate the new double helix of finance: where identity and technology are not just intertwined, but inseparable.

UK Financial Innovators

Crown Agents Bank has tackled the long-standing challenges of cross-border payments in emerging markets by integrating biometric verification and document authentication into its onboarding process. This approach minimises fraud risks and ensures regulatory compliance for customers lacking traditional documentation, empowering financial inclusion across borders.

 

Griffin, a Banking-as-a-Service (BaaS) provider, has adopted an API-first strategy, embedding identity verification directly into its platform. By partnering with Veriff, Griffin enables fintech clients to automate biometric checks and document reviews, streamlining onboarding while maintaining robust AML compliance. This integration reduces friction, improves conversion rates, and allows fintechs to focus on innovation without sacrificing regulatory rigour.

US Fintechs and Global Examples

Breakout Capital, a leading US fintech lender, has replaced manual, error-prone identity checks with digital ID verification (IDV) to secure small business lending. This shift has significantly reduced fraud and streamlined operations, with borrowers welcoming the quick, robust verification as a sign of trustworthiness and professionalism.

 

In Kenya, M-Pesa is a transformative example of mobile identity as the backbone of the national financial infrastructure. Launched to serve the unbanked, M-Pesa uses SIM-based identity to authenticate users, enabling person-to-person transfers, microloans, and bill payments. This leapfrog innovation has drastically reduced financial exclusion, driven economic resilience, and made mobile money ubiquitous, even in regions where internet access is limited.

DeFi and Self-Sovereign Identity

DeFi platforms are at the forefront of self-sovereign identity (SSI), allowing users to own and manage their digital credentials without reliance on centralised authorities. Leveraging blockchain, these systems use decentralised identifiers (DIDS) and verifiable credentials, enabling individuals to control what data they share and with whom. 

 

Projects like uPort and Sovrin empower users to authenticate themselves across platforms while preserving privacy, aligning with DeFi’s ethos of autonomy and trustlessness. This paradigm shift reduces the risk of data breaches and paves the way for interoperable, reusable identity verification, making the user, not the institution, the ultimate arbiter of trust.

Mutual Reinforcement: Technology Drives Identity, Identity Drives Technology

The arms race between fraudsters and financial institutions has ushered in a new era of identity verification powered by artificial intelligence, advanced biometrics, and blockchain.

AI-driven systems now analyse datasets in real time, detecting anomalies and patterns that signal fraudulent activity, while biometric authentication, ranging from facial and voice recognition to keystroke and gait analysis, offers a uniquely personal, unforgeable layer of security.

Blockchain’s decentralised architecture further ensures that identity data remains tamper-proof and transparent, enabling secure, cross-platform verification without relying on a single point of failure.

As fraud tactics become more sophisticated- think deepfakes, synthetic identities, and fraud-as-a-service platforms- identity verification technology is forced to evolve just as rapidly.

AI-generated forgeries and hyper-realistic deepfakes have made traditional detection methods obsolete, pushing the industry toward self-learning, bias-tested AI models and multi-factor authentication that can adapt in real time. This feedback loop ensures that every leap in fraud capability is met with an equally robust leap in defence, turning identity verification into a dynamic, ever-advancing discipline.

The fusion of advanced identity systems with financial technology is not just about defence-it’s a launchpad for new business models. Open banking and embedded finance rely on seamless, secure digital identities to enable instant onboarding, frictionless payments, and personalised financial services. Digital wallets are evolving into asset-centric identity vaults, storing everything from government IDS to tokenised assets.

At the same time, DeFi platforms use blockchain-based identities to facilitate trustless transactions and compliance without intermediaries—the result: a financial ecosystem where identity is both the gatekeeper and the key to innovation.
